    Compensation Range: 150-200k About PREMION Premion, a division of TEGNA, is a first-in-market advertising services platform that offers local and regional advertisers access to premium long-form episodic content through one streamlined solution. Premion is a new division of TEGNA. Premion aggregates advertising inventory from more than 80 OTT inventory sources providing a one-stop-shop for regional and local advertisers. Premion has rolled out nationwide with ability to deliver campaigns in single and multiple DMAs, leveraging TEGNA's sales force of more than 700 across the country, connecting its more than 14,000 local and regional advertising clients. About TEGNA TEGNA Inc. (NYSE: TGNA) is an innovative media company that serves the greater good of our communities. Across platforms, TEGNA tells empowering stories, conducts impactful investigations and delivers innovative marketing solutions. With 64 television stations in 51 U.S. markets, TEGNA is the largest owner of top 4 network affiliates in the top 25 markets among independent station groups, reaching approximately 39 percent of all television households nationwide. TEGNA also owns leading multicast networks True Crime Network and Quest. TEGNA Marketing Solutions (TMS) offers innovative solutions to help businesses reach consumers across television, digital and over-the-top (OTT) platforms, including Premion, TEGNA's OTT advertising service.
